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 6.5 | 294 | CRYSTALS OF TRP138HIS NIR WERE GROWN BY THE HANGING-DROP VAPOUR DIFFUSION METHOD AT 21OC. 2ML OF 6-8 MG ML-1 PROTEIN IN 10 MM TRIS-HCL PH 7.1 WAS MIXED WITH AN EQUAL VOLUME OF RESERVOIR SOLUTION CONSISTING OF 25% PEG-MME 550, 10 MM ZINC SULPHATE, 0.1M MES PH 6.5 AND SUSPENDED OVER A 500 ML RESERVOIR. CRYSTALS WERE AN INTENSE BLUE COLOUR AND GREW WITHIN TWO DAYS TO APPROXIMATE DIMENSIONS 0.9 X 0.6 X 0.1 MM IN A RHOMBOHEDRAL MORPHOLOGY. |
